Transaction fde76461665edfa02d02cf53435f6a8a951af201854a816a27d235027255c0d0
1 Input
1 Output
-
fde76461665edfa02d02cf53435f6a8a951af201854a816a27d235027255c0d0:0
- value
- 25438
- script pubkey
- OP_0 OP_PUSHBYTES_20 c245955586e37a9624144e47dae2f4eaa8884794
- address
- bc1qcfze24vxudafvfq5fera4ch5a25gs3u5mjagnw